在使用GitHub时,用户经常会遇到一个棘手的问题:GitHub网站不显示图片。无论是文档、README文件还是其他Markdown文件,图片无法正常显示可能会导致内容传达的效果大打折扣。本文将深入探讨这个问题的可能原因及解决方案,帮助你快速恢复图片的显示。
什么是GitHub?
GitHub是一个流行的代码托管平台,它支持使用Git进行版本控制。用户可以通过GitHub分享和管理代码,也可以使用它来发布项目文档,通常会用到Markdown语言来格式化内容。
GitHub上图片不显示的常见原因
在讨论解决方案之前,我们先了解一些GitHub网站不显示图片的常见原因:
- 图片链接错误:图片的URL不正确或链接到不存在的图片。
- 权限问题:图片存储在私有库中,权限设置不当,导致无法访问。
- 格式不支持:某些图片格式可能不被支持,导致无法显示。
- 网络问题:本地网络问题可能导致无法加载远程图片。
如何解决GitHub网站不显示图片的问题
1. 检查图片链接
- 确保图片的URL是正确的,且路径无误。
- 如果是相对路径,确保文件结构没有变化。
2. 检查权限设置
- 如果图片存储在私有仓库中,确保当前用户有足够的权限来访问这些图片。
- 考虑将图片上传到公开仓库或者使用外部图床服务。
3. 图片格式检查
- 确保上传的图片是常用格式,如JPEG、PNG或GIF,避免使用不常见的格式。
4. 试用不同的网络环境
- 尝试在不同的网络环境中加载GitHub页面,例如切换到移动数据或其他Wi-Fi网络。
- 清除浏览器缓存后再次尝试。
5. 使用Markdown语法正确引用图片
确保使用正确的Markdown语法插入图片,格式如下:
GitHub图片上传的最佳实践
在上传图片时,遵循以下最佳实践,可以减少图片不显示的问题:
- 使用统一的命名规范,避免使用特殊字符。
- 将图片存储在特定的文件夹中,以保持文件的有序管理。
- 定期检查图片的可用性,确保所有链接有效。
相关工具与资源
- GitHub Desktop:方便管理本地GitHub项目。
- Imgur:免费图片托管服务,适合公开分享。
FAQ(常见问题解答)
GitHub支持哪些图片格式?
GitHub支持的主要图片格式包括JPEG、PNG和GIF。尽量避免使用其他格式。
如何将图片上传到GitHub?
你可以在GitHub的项目页面中直接上传图片,或者通过Git命令将图片文件推送到仓库中。确保文件夹结构整洁,便于管理。
GitHub上的图片链接可以公开访问吗?
如果图片存储在公开仓库中,任何人都可以访问。如果存储在私有仓库中,只有具有访问权限的用户才能查看。
为什么图片在我的设备上显示,但在GitHub上不显示?
可能是由于权限问题或网络连接问题,建议检查图片的链接和权限设置。
如何确认图片是否上传成功?
可以通过访问图片的URL,直接在浏览器中打开来确认。如果图片能够正常显示,说明上传成功。
结论
解决GitHub网站不显示图片的问题并不复杂,通常只需检查图片链接、权限和格式。通过遵循最佳实践,你可以有效减少此类问题的发生。希望本文能够帮助你顺利地使用GitHub来管理和分享项目。
正文完